Wartime NAAFI Insignia.
Uncommon insignia for a uniformed officer of the NAAFI ( Navy, Army and Air Force Institutes ) . Created by the British government in 1921 to run recreational establishments needed by the British Armed Forces, and to sell goods to servicemen and their families the NAAFI played it's greatest role during WW2 when it ran 7,000 canteens and had 96,000 personnel including control of ENSA.
This KD slip on shoulder insignia displays the NAAFI colours and the insignia of an Inspector. Good, used condition.
